Knowing how the stun works allows for stupid things in Melee. However, in my Doc's case, the slowed down combos aren't necessarily because I know what I'm doing. It's because I'm just not good with him yet.Another thing is your "slowed-down combos." Bear with me here. I've seen this multiple times, where your opponent is in hitstun and you're right next to them. Normally you would continue the combo and attack, but you wait and somehow that waiting elicits an even more devastating finish.
Again, it's about positional advantage, at least for me. If I'm behind you and your shield is up, you can't do anything aside from shine out of shield as Fox/up b as Link, or dsmash outta shield as Peach. Beyond that, most characters are forced to take actions that can be responded to on pure reaction, rather than guesswork. Essentially, we're eliminating the need to guess. There are plenty of ways to prevent it, but if you guys aren't doing it, there's no reason to stop, amirite?Another thing Steven and I see is that you just "run past your opponent" when you should simply attack them on the spot. If i'm hiding in my shield, normally you would either dashgrab or predict our spot dodge and dash attack. But you guys instead run PAST our shield and "wait."
I think your biggest problem is that you're in the mindset that most of CO was before we had Forward come down (up?). You're focusing on pure technical prowess and speed. It works against scrubs, and it works against El Paso (LOLOLOL), but on higher levels, players know what is good in what situation, and can punish predictable play no matter HOW fast you are.
